No, CAT is not compulsory to take admission in Narayana Business School MBA/PGDM programme. The college considers valid scores of MBA entrance exam such as: XAT/NMAT/CMAT fo rgiving admission. The college also conducts it's own entrance exam called NBSAT. Candidates can produce scores of any of these exams for taking admission in Narayana Business School.

Candidates can check below the list of documents required at the time of admission at Narayana Business School:
- Class 10 marksheet
- Class 12 marksheet
- Graduation Marksheet
- Entrance exam scorecard
- Aadhaar Card
- Transfer Certificate
- Charcater Certificate
- Work Experience letter (if any)
- Passport-size Photo
Note: This is generic list. It can change.

Candidates wishing to take admission in Narayana Business School in the MBA or PGDM courses should have completed the eligibility. They have to fill the application form on the official website of college. Candidates also need to apply and appear for MBA entrance exams such as CAT/XAT/NMAT/CMAT/ NBSAT. Following this, they also have to clear the psychometric test and personal interview round.

Candidates can check below the accepted exams and minimum cutoff for admission in Narayana Business School:
Exam | Cutoff |
|---|---|
CAT | At least 75 percentile |
XAT | At least 70 percentile |
CMAT | At least 80 percentile |
NMAT | At least 180 |
NBSAT | Mandatory in case of score below cutoff in other exams |

Narayana Business School CAT Cutoff 2025 has been released for admission to the MBA/PGDM course. The CAT Cutoff 2025 was 75 percentile for the students belonging to the General category under the All India quota. The CAT exam (Common Admission Test) was conducted by IIM Kozhikode. The CAT exam is India's top MBA entrance examination.
